#867EAC Hex Color Code

#867EAC

The Hexadecimal Color #867EAC is a contrast shade of Light Slate Gray. #867EAC RGB value is rgb(134, 126, 172). RGB Color Model of #867EAC consists of 52% red, 49% green and 67% blue. HSL color Mode of #867EAC has 250°(degrees) Hue, 22% Saturation and 58% Lightness. #867EAC color has an wavelength of 462.59259n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#867EAC is #9999CC.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#867EAC is #87A. The Closest Color to #867EAC is #778899. Official Name of #867EAC Hex Code is Lavender Purple.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#867EAC is 22 Cyan 27 Magenta 0 Yellow 33 Black and #867EAC CMY is 22, 27,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#867EAC is hsl(250,22,58,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(250, 27, 67).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#867EAC is 24.74, 22.97, 42.15.
Hex8 Value of #867EAC is #867EACFF. Decimal Value of #867EAC is 8814252 and Octal Value of #867EAC is 41477254. Binary Value of #867EAC is 10000110, 1111110, 10101100 and Android of #867EAC is 4287004332 / 0xff867eac.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#867EAC is 0.275, 0.256, 0.256 and YIQ Color Space of #867EAC is 133.636, -10.0126, 16.0072.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#867EAC is 21.15, 21.84, 41.84.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#867EAC is 55.04, 13.03, -23.28.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#867EAC is 55.04, 1.27, -36.73.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#867EAC is 55.04, 26.68, 299.24. Hunter Lab variable of #867EAC is 47.93, 8.27, -18.59.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#867EAC

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
